Copenhagen's remote location means that proximity to healthcare providers is a critical factor. Many residents travel to Watertown or beyond for specialized medical services, so selecting a health insurance company with a broad network that includes regional hospitals and clinics is essential. Companies like Excellus BlueCross BlueShield, MVP Health Care, and Fidelis Care are commonly recognized in upstate New York and often provide plans that cover services at nearby facilities like Samaritan Medical Center. It's wise to verify that your preferred local doctors and the Carthage Area Hospital are in-network before committing to a plan. This step can prevent unexpected out-of-pocket costs and ensure seamless care coordination. For those navigating insurance independently, Copenhagen offers local resources to help. The Lewis County Public Health Department and community organizations sometimes provide guidance on enrollment and subsidy eligibility. Remember, open enrollment periods are crucial, but life events like marriage or job loss can trigger special enrollment opportunities.
